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Primary teeth (extracted /exfoliated) 2. Non -carious tooth 3. Non - restored tooth 4. Fresh to date packaged milk 5. Ready to eat cereals 6. Packaged juices and flavoured milk
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Previously endodontically treated tooth. Fractured teeth. Expired packaged cereals, milk, orange juice along with flavoured milk
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Quantitative assessment of mineral loss (Calcium and Phosphorus depletion) from primary tooth enamel after exposure to flavoured milk, orange juice, plain cereal, chocolate cereal, and fruit cereal, as measured by EDX analysis. Qualitative evaluation of surface roughness and morphological changes of primary tooth enamel following exposure to the test foods using Scanning Electron Microscopy (SEM). Quantitative assessment of mineral loss (Calcium and Phosphorus depletion) from primary tooth enamel after exposure to flavoured milk, orange juice, plain cereal, chocolate cereal, and fruit cereal, as measured by EDX analysis.Timepoint: 2 days | — |
